I have my loglimit set to 100 entries for each ipfw rule. Is there a way in periodic.conf or such to automatically execute "ipfw resetlog"? My log entires fill up in about 2 days due to attempted tcp connections to http, telnet, netbios, ect. I would like to keep the loglimit active to prevent syslog flooding, and still get attempted connections logged to me everyday. Thanks.
